Blog – Author Guidelines

The Bangladesh Dialogue welcomes blog submissions from authors who can provide insightful, evidence-based, and thought-provoking content on public policy, governance, economics, international relations, sustainable development, social issues, and other topics relevant to Bangladesh and the global context. Submissions should be emailed to <thebangladeshdialogue@gmail.com> and must comply with the guidelines outlined below.

1. Submission Format

  • All articles must be submitted in Microsoft Word (.doc or .docx) format.
  • Ensure the document is fully editable, free of unnecessary formatting, embedded objects, or tracked changes.
  • Include any figures, tables, or images in-line or as separate files, with proper captions and references.
  • Submissions should be original and not under consideration elsewhere.

2. Article Structure

Your submission should follow a clear and professional structure:

  1. Title: Provide a concise, engaging, and descriptive title that reflects the content of the article.
  2. Author Name: Include the full name of the author directly below the title.
  3. Main Body:
    1. Articles should be well-organisedwith a logical flow of ideas.
    1. Use subheadings to improve readability where appropriate.
    1. Support claims with evidence, data, or references to credible sources.
    1. Avoid jargon unless necessary; define technical terms when used.
    1. Maintain a professional and neutral tone, suitable for a policy and research audience.
  4. References / Citations
    1. Include a list of references at the end of the article in a consistent citation style (e.g., APA, Chicago, or MLA).
    1. Ensure all external sources are properly cited.
  5. Author Note (Bio)
    1. Include a brief author biography of no more than 30 words.
    1. Example: “MR. Asif Sarkar is a researcher specialising in governance, public policy, and democratic institutions.”

3. Word Count

  • Standard articles should be 1,000-2,000 words.
  • Longer pieces covering novel or urgent issues may be considered, subject to editorial review.

4. Language

  • Submissions can be in English or Bangla.
  • Articles in other languages must be translated into English or Bangla prior to submission.
  • Maintain clarity, proper grammar, and readability in the chosen language.

5. Originality and Ethics

  • Articles must be original and unpublished.
  • Properly attribute all sources, data, and quotations.
  • Avoid conflicts of interest; disclose any affiliations relevant to the content.

6. Review and Publication

  • All submissions undergo editorial review for quality, relevance, and adherence to guidelines.
  • TBD reserves the right to edit for clarity, style, and length prior to publication.
  • Authors may be asked to revise content based on editorial feedback.

7. Submission Process

  • Email submissions to: thebangladeshdialogue@gmail.com
  • Include a cover note briefly summarizing the article topic and its relevance.
  • Attach all supplementary materials (figures, tables, images) as separate files if necessary.
